shuma.c

来自「单片机应用」· C语言 代码 · 共 32 行

C
32
字号
#include <AT89X51.H>
#include <INTRINS.H>
unsigned char code table[]={0x3f,0x06,0x5b,0x4f,0x66,
0x6d,0x7d,0x07,0x7f,0x6f};
unsigned char i;
/*void delay02(void)
 {
  unsigned m,n,p;
  for(m=20;m<0;m--)
  for(n=20;n<0;n--)
  for(p=248;p<0;p--);
 }*/
 void delay02(void)
 {
  unsigned m;
  for(m=500;m<0;m--)
  {
   _nop_();
   }
 }
 void main(void)
 {
   while(1)
    {
	 for(i=0;i<10;i++)
	 {
	 P1=table[i];
	 delay02();
	 }
	}
 }

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?